Abstract

Zha Shibiao is an important painter in the "Xin'an School of Painting", and his painting style had a great influence on the literati painters at that time. For his life, he drifted all his life. For many years, he walked in the places of three wu and Zhejiang, visiting fame and making friends extensively at the same time, without class or age. This unique experience provided rich nourishment for him to form a unique painting style. This paper explores the influence of Zha Shibiao on his painting style through his dating travel.
